his Quitclaim Deed from Individual to Two Individuals in Joint Tenancy form is a Quitclaim Deed where the Granter is an individual and the Grantees are two individuals. Granter conveys and quitclaims the described property to Grantees less and except all oil, gas and minerals, on and under the property owned by Granter, if any, which are reserved by Granter. How to fill out nebraska quitclaim deed from

How to fill out Nebraska quitclaim deed form:
01
Begin by obtaining the Nebraska quitclaim deed form. This form can be obtained from various sources, such as legal online platforms or local county clerk's offices.
02
Fill in the names of the grantor(s) and grantee(s). The grantor is the current owner of the property, while the grantee is the individual or entity receiving the property.
03
Provide a legal description of the property being transferred. This should include the exact boundaries of the property, such as lot numbers or metes and bounds descriptions.
04
Indicate the county and state where the property is located.
05
Include any necessary additional information, such as the property address or any encumbrances or restrictions that may apply.
06
Sign and date the quitclaim deed form. All parties involved in the transaction, including the grantor and the grantee, should sign the document in the presence of a notary public.
07
Submit the completed Nebraska quitclaim deed form to the county clerk's office where the property is located. It is recommended to make copies of the form for your records as well.
Who needs Nebraska quitclaim deed form:
01
Individuals who want to transfer property ownership without making any warranties or guarantees about the property's condition or title.
02
Divorcing couples who need to transfer ownership of a jointly owned property to one spouse.
03
Family members or friends who want to gift property to someone else.
04
Individuals who want to add or remove someone's name from the property title without selling the property.
Note: It is always advisable to consult with a qualified attorney or real estate professional when filling out legal documents like a quitclaim deed.

What is nebraska quitclaim deed from?
A Nebraska quitclaim deed is a legal document used to transfer interest or ownership of real property in Nebraska without making any warranties or guarantees about the title of the property.
Who is required to file nebraska quitclaim deed from?
The person or party who wishes to transfer their interest or ownership of a property in Nebraska is required to file a quitclaim deed.
How to fill out nebraska quitclaim deed from?
To fill out a Nebraska quitclaim deed form, you need to provide the names of the grantor (the person transferring the property) and the grantee (the person receiving the property), a legal description of the property, and any relevant attachments or exhibits. It is recommended to consult a legal professional for precise instructions and guidance.
What is the purpose of nebraska quitclaim deed from?
The purpose of a Nebraska quitclaim deed is to legally transfer the interest or ownership of a property from one party to another, without making any warranties or guarantees about the title of the property.
What information must be reported on nebraska quitclaim deed from?
The Nebraska quitclaim deed form typically requires information such as the names and addresses of the grantor and grantee, a legal description of the property being transferred, and any relevant attachments or exhibits.
